Markets set equilibrium, not Treasury Secretaries.

Bessent thinks he's the "house," the guy with special "insight," to use his term, that gives him an advantage over the punters. Yet he himself headed George Soros's London trading desk when his firm (correctly) thought that it was smarter than the Bank of England.

The fact is that our debt is ballooning and we now have the spectacle of the US defending the Japanese yen so as to avoid the Japanese needing to sell their bloated Treasury holdings.

The words I'd use to describe Bessent are blasé and complacent. That comes across in the article in the following passage:

"Bessent did not appear particularly concerned about America’s ballooning debt this week, however.

“ 'The U.S. bond market has been the best-performing bond market in the world since President Trump came in,' [Bessent] said at an event at Southern Methodist University."
